David C. Levin, MD, first became interested in medicine while serving as a jet fighter pilot in the U.S. Air Force after having graduated from Cornell University. He subsequently received his medical degree from the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ine, then did a surgical internship and radiology residency at the University of California, Los Angeles Medical Center. During the course of his career in academic radiology, he has held faculty appointments at the New York Hospital-Cornell Medical Center, State University of New York Downstate Medical Center, and Harvard Medical School. While at Harvard, he was head of cardiovascular/interventional radiology at the Brigham and Women's Hospital, before being appointed acting chairman of that department.

He came to Jefferson as a radiology chairman in 1986 and held that post for 16 years before stepping down at the end of June 2002. Since then, he has served as a consultant for HealthHelp, Inc., a radiology benefits management company based in Houston; on the board of directors of OIA, LLC, an imaging center development firm based in Nashville, TN; and as a consultant in radiology for ECRI, a healthcare technology consulting firm. He also continues to work in Jefferson's department of radiology doing coronary CT angiography, health services research, and teaching. All of these are part-time positions.

Dr. Levin has served as chairman of the Council on Cardiovascular Radiology and Intervention of the American Heart Association and president of the Society of Chairs of Academic Radiology Departments. At the RSNA, he served as chair of the cardiovascular section of the Program Committee, head of the health policy and practice section of the Refresher Course Committee, and chair of the Health Policy and Practice Committee.
